In May 2012 the first edition of Council’s Inside Adelaide print edition was launched followed by Inside Adelaide Online a couple of months later in July, 2012.

Inside Adelaide, both online and print, have a reputation for being a trusted source of up-to-date Council news. They complement each other by providing information to our community about Council's key projects, services and efforts on co-creation through community involvement.

We asked you to complete a survey, and go into a prize draw by providing us with feedback on both print and online versions. This will help inform Council for ways to provide you with news in the future, and help us ensure we are meeting your needs as the community of the City of Adelaide.
